How to Spend a Day in Bentota, Sri Lanka – A Memorable Day Trip Guide for Fun and Adventure 

Bentota, nestled along Sri Lanka’s southwestern coast, is the perfect location for a day trip filled with cultural exploration, pristine beaches, and captivating experiences. With this comprehensive guide, visitors are all set to embark on an unforgettable day trip in Bentota, immersing themselves in its natural beauty, rich heritage, and vibrant culture.

Getting Started in the Morning 

Begin the day trip bright and early to maximise one’s time exploring all that Bentota has to offer. When it comes to travel arrangements, it is best recommended that visitors arrange transportation for sightseeing, especially if they are not staying at a hotel in Bentota already. Before embarking on the adventurous day ahead, do not forget to eat! No day is complete without breakfast, so start the day with a delightful and energising breakfast at a local eatery or one of the many restaurants/cafés located along Galle Road. Enjoy a mix of local and international flavours while sipping on a cup of hot tea or coffee, before exciting adventures commence. 

After breakfast, consider heading to Bentota Beach, where one can sink their toes into the soft golden sands. Take a leisurely stroll along the beach or take a refreshing dip in the cool, blue waters, or simply relax under the shade of palm trees swaying to and fro in the ocean breeze before starting on the next part of the itinerary.

Midday and Afternoon Activities 

Embark on a short drive to Lunuganga Estate, the former residence of renowned Sri Lankan architect Geoffrey Bawa. Explore the meticulously landscaped gardens, dotted with stunning architecture and a serene infinity pool at the end of the gardens. It’s a true haven for nature lovers and architecture enthusiasts alike. 

Not just in Bentota for sightseeing? For hardcore adrenaline junkies, Bentota offers an extensive array of watersports activities. From jet skiing and banana boat rides to snorkelling and diving, there’s something for everyone to enjoy the thrill of the ocean. 

All this activity is bound to develop a voracious appetite in anyone, so refuel with a scrumptious lunch at one of the local eateries serving authentic Sri Lankan cuisine or opt for a beachside restaurant offering freshly cooked seafood. Do consider informing waitstaff at restaurants/cafés of any dietary preferences. 

There is a lot that Bentota has on offer, so do consider extending the stay to visit more places of interest. If Lunuganga was an unforgettable visit, venture to Brief Garden, which is another masterpiece by famed architect Geoffrey Bawa. Nature enthusiasts are bound to love the lush greenery, vibrant flora, and artistic sculptures that adorn this enchanting garden. 

After exploring the Brief Garden, be sure to embark on a memorable boat safari along the Madu River. Navigate through mangrove tunnels, observe exotic bird species, and visit a cinnamon island to witness the traditional cinnamon-making process. This river safari remains one of the most popular things to do in Bentota

A Delightful Evening in Bentota 

Wrap up this exciting day trip with a visit to Paradise Island, just off the coast of Bentota. Marvel at the breathtaking sunset views while strolling along the pristine shores and watch the sky ablaze with hues of orange and pink.

Important Tips for a Comfortable Day Trip 

Day trips can be plenty of fun but exhausting. Practise these essential tips to make the most of a day trip whilst prioritising comfort. Pack essentials such as sunscreen, hats, and swimwear for a comfortable day under the sun. Do consider making reservations well in advance for activities and dining to avoid any last-minute hassles. Remember to respect local customs, by dressing modestly and adhering to local traditions while exploring cultural sites and other places of interest. Visitors are encouraged to keep hydrated throughout the day, especially in the warm, tropical climate of Bentota. Pack a reusable water bottle, which can easily be refilled at any restaurant/café and sip on water from time to time to avoid getting dehydrated.
